Abstract

The invention relates to pyrimido[5,4-e][1,2,4]triazine-5,7-diones, p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of and physiologically functional derivatives. The invention therefore relates to compounds of the formula I, in which the radicals have the given meanings, and to their physiologically tolerated salts and processes for preparing them. The compounds are suitable for use as antidiabetics, for example.

Claims (21)

1. A method of lowering blood sugar which comprises administering to a patient in need thereof a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of a compound of formula I,

in which

R1 is (C 1 -C 6 )-alkyl;

R3 is (C 1 -C 6 )-alkyl-phenyl or (C 2 -C 6 )-alkenyl-phenyl, where the phenyl ring can be substituted by F, Cl, Br, OR13 or R13;

R4 is (C 1 -C 6 )-alkyl or (C 1 -C 6 )-alkylene-D; and

R13 is (C 1 -C 6 )-alkyl or phenyl;

or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.
